When crate training a puppy, the crate should typically not be bigger than the puppy, and the puppy should not be able to do more than circle around and lie down. Shimajiro is a very popular education program in Japan. The titular character is a young cartoon tiger. The show teaches kids about manners, vocabulary, shapes, household chores and even toilet training. This is the 2009 version of the toilet training segment with subtitle goodness!
